Job description

We are seeking a motivated, responsible, and personable individuals to join our team as a Personal Trainer. In this role, you will lead clients safely and effectively to achieve their personal fitness and wellness goals. Personal Trainers work under the direction of the Fitness Coordinators at the Marsh and Williston Centers. This is a part-time position with flexible hours.

Please Note: This position will be Small Group Session focused with Evening availability.

  • Ensure proper use and maintenance of all fitness and exercise equipment at the Marsh and Williston Centers, promoting safe and efficient operations.
  • Communicate equipment issues, training concerns, or member needs to the Fitness Coordinators.
  • Assist members in developing proper techniques and skills to participate safely in exercise programs.
  • Provide information and guidance to members, guests, and staff regarding personal training sessions and opportunities.
  • Lead participants through safe and effective activities, including aerobic, strength, and functional training.
  • Complete all required forms related to medical history, doctor's permissions, injuries, complaints, and special requests.
Other Job Functions:
  • Communicate member concerns, complaints, or feedback to the Fitness Coordinators.
  • Serve as a substitute instructor for fitness classes, as experience and expertise allow.
  • Perform other duties and assume additional responsibilities as assigned.
Minimum Qualifications:
  • Commitment to and alignment with Minnetonka's shared values.
  • Current Personal Training certification from a nationally accredited organization (e.g., NATA, AFAA, ACE).
  • Current CPR certification (ARC or AHA).
  • Strong customer service skills, including the ability to address client concerns professionally.
Desired Qualifications:
  • Previous health club or related personal training experience.
  • First aid certification.
Work Schedule:
  • Flexible Part-time position with evening and weekend hours.
  • Training sessions at Marsh and Williston
  • Reports to the Sr. Fitness Coordinator
Knowledge, Skills & Abilities:
Knowledge of:
  • Safe and effective teaching practices and use of all equipment.
Skilled in:
  • Effectively dealing with the privacy concerns of clients.
  • The development of safe and individualized exercise plans.
Ability to:
  • Instruct others in the use of a variety of health fitness and athletic equipment.
  • Learn Williston Center policies, programs and practices.
